Problem 10-2

An automatic filling machine is used to fill 1-liter bottles of cola. The machines output is approximately normal with a mean of 0.91 liter and a standard deviation of 0.03 liter. Output is monitored using means of samples of 27 observations. Use Table-A.

a.

Determine upper and lower control limits that will include roughly 97 percent of the sample means when the process is in control. (Do not round intermediate calculations. Round z value to 2 decimal places. Round your answers to 4 decimal places.)

Upper control limits: liter
Lower control limits: liter

b.

Given these sample means: 1.005, 1.001, .998, 1.002, .995, and .999, is the process in control?

  • No

  • Yes
